Afternoon Theater (also Saturday Night Theater) was a long-running radio drama strand on BBC Radio 4. Launched in April 1943, Afternoon Theater showcased feature-length, middle-brow single plays for more than 50 years. The plays featured included stage plays, book adaptations and original dramatizations. For most of its history, programs ran for 90 minutes and were largely entertainment-centered, including thrillers, comedies and mysteries.
